How Fruit Machine Mechanics Work: Nudges, Holds, and Respin Logic
A nudge typically appears after a spin that lands a winning symbol one row above or below the payline. The game offers a “nudge down” or “nudge up” button, moving the reel by one or two positions. A hold freezes one or more reels while the rest spin again, often used when you have two matching symbols on a payline and need a third. These features are not random; they are coded into the game’s paytable and trigger under specific conditions. Most modern fruit machines combine nudges with holds in a single bonus round, giving you multiple attempts to improve a partial win. Reading RTP and Volatility Correctly Under UKGC Rules
RTP, or return to player, is the theoretical percentage of stakes returned over millions of spins. A game with 96% RTP does not guarantee you £96 back from £100 wagered; it is a long-term statistical average. Volatility describes the frequency and size of wins. Low volatility pays small amounts often; high volatility pays larger sums less frequently. Every UKGC-licensed game must have its RNG (random number generator) certified by an approved testing lab such as eCOGRA or iTech Labs. This certification ensures that the hold and nudge outcomes are genuinely random and not rigged to favour the house beyond the stated RTP. UK Stake Limits and Responsible Session Structure in 2026
Since 2025, the UK Gambling Commission has enforced a maximum stake of £5 per spin for online slots, and £2 per spin for players aged 18 to 24. These limits apply to all slot games, including fruit machines with nudges and holds. The £5 cap means that a single nudge or hold decision cannot cost more than £5. Operators must also display a session timer and loss limits before you start playing. You can set a deposit limit, a loss limit, or a time limit in your account settings. The credit card ban has been in place since April 2020, so deposits must come from a debit card, e-wallet, or bank transfer. Quickfire Answers: Five Common Questions About Fruit Machines
What is the difference between a nudge and a hold in fruit machines?
A nudge moves a reel by one or two positions after a spin, usually to complete a winning line. A hold freezes one or more reels in place while the remaining reels respin. Both features give you control over the outcome, but a hold is more strategic because it preserves a partial win while the rest of the reels try to improve it.
When should I use a nudge versus a hold in a game?
Use a nudge when a single symbol is just above or below the payline and moving it would create a win. Use a hold when you already have two matching symbols on a payline and need a third from a respin. The game usually prompts you with the best option, but understanding the logic helps you decide faster.
Why do some fruit machines have lower RTP than others?
RTP is set by the game developer and reflects the mathematical edge built into the software. Progressive jackpot games often have lower RTP (around 88%) because a portion of each bet funds the jackpot pool. Standard fruit machines with holds and nudges tend to have RTP between 94% and 97%.
